Yotes push winning streak to seven

Ashley Leffingwell crushed a 3-run HR in the second game.

Softball | 4/10/2016 9:42:00 PM

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2 SEASIDE (April 10, 2016) -- Not even a two-hour rain delay could deter the Coyotes in playing some of their best softball of the season.

CSUSB took care of business in its weekend series against Cal State Monterey Bay, take a four-game sweep with Sunday's 8-2 and 8-3 victories.

The Coyotes (26-21, 17-15 CCAA) have won seven straight and eight of their last nine before next weekend's series at UC San Diego.

Game 1: Coyotes 8, CSU Monterey Bay 3
Trailing 3-0 through three innings, the Coyotes got on track scoring eight unanswered runs for the victory.

A bases-loaded walk gave Jessica Brown an RBI, and Monica Maddox followed with a three-run triple that gave CSUSB a 4-3 lead in the fourth inning and Morgan Ratliff pushed the lead to 5-3 on a ground out in which the Coyotes sent eight to the plate on just two hits.

Then in the fifth, CSUSB extended the lead to 8-3 with a double from Kaylee Gemmell and RBIs from Brown (single) and Cassandra Williams (fielder's choice).

Amanda Ramirez earned the start, and Williams finished off the Otters in four innings of relief with three strikeouts.

Amanda Herrera continued her hot-hitting on a 3-for-4 game.

Game 2: Coyotes 8, CSU Monterey Bay 2
Ramirez performed extremely well on the mound with six shut-out innings after the Otters tied the game at 2-2 in the first.

She had one strikeout and did not offer a walk in improving her record to 6-5. She gave up only four hits after the opening frame.

The Coyotes broke away from a 2-2 game in the fifth. Back-to-back run-scoring singles from Ashley Leffingwell and Caitlyn Olan gave CSUSB a 4-2 lead, and Brianna Quintana earned an RBI on a sacrifice bunt.

Leffingwell then gave her team a big boost with a three-run home run to left for the 8-2 lead.

CSUSB had 12 hits with Ratliff, Jessica Angulo, Gemmell, Caelan Smith and Leffingwell all with two hits.
